The Growth Hormone Releasing Peptide, In Plain Words
You may have heard about a bioidentical hormone therapy that mimics a natural hormone your body produces. This substance acts on the pituitary gland, encouraging it to release more growth hormone in a pulsatile manner. This mimics the body’s natural, youthful secretion patterns. It’s not a synthetic hormone itself but a GHRH analog. Think of it as a key that signals your body to produce more of its own vital growth hormone.
When your body releases more growth hormone, a cascade of benefits can follow. Growth hormone stimulates the liver to produce IGF-1, or Insulin-like Growth Factor 1. This protein plays a crucial role in cellular repair, muscle growth, bone density, and metabolism. For many, this translates to improved sleep quality, increased energy levels, better body composition, and enhanced recovery from physical exertion. It supports the body’s natural regenerative processes.
Over time, natural growth hormone production declines. This decline can contribute to many signs of aging, such as reduced muscle mass, increased body fat, slower wound healing, and decreased bone density. This particular peptide therapy aims to gently restore a more youthful hormone profile. It encourages your pituitary gland to function more like it did when you were younger. This can make a noticeable difference in how you feel and function daily.
How A Real Prescription Is Obtained From Florida
Accessing this type of therapy requires a legitimate prescription from a licensed medical professional. Because it’s a compounded medication, it falls under specific regulatory guidelines. This means you cannot simply buy it over the counter or from unregulated sources. The process ensures your safety and the therapy’s efficacy. You need a doctor who understands your specific health needs.
Telehealth has made this process remarkably accessible for residents here. You begin by completing a comprehensive online medical intake form. This questionnaire delves into your health history, current symptoms, lifestyle, and wellness goals. It’s designed to give the clinician a thorough understanding of your individual situation. This asynchronous approach allows you to complete it on your schedule, without needing to book time off for an in-person visit. It respects your busy life.
Following your intake, a licensed Florida physician reviews your information. They will then determine if this therapy is medically appropriate for you. If it is, they will issue a prescription. This prescription is then sent to a compounding pharmacy. These pharmacies specialize in creating personalized medications based on a doctor’s order. Your medication is then shipped directly to your home. This ensures you receive a high-quality, accurately compounded product.

What The Timeline Looks Like
After you complete your online intake, the physician reviews your case. This review typically takes a few business days. Once approved, the prescription is sent to the compounding pharmacy. They then prepare and ship your medication. You can generally expect to receive your first shipment within one to two weeks from your initial consultation approval. This streamlined process minimizes waiting time.
Many patients report noticing initial subtle changes within the first few weeks of consistent use. These might include improvements in sleep quality or a slight increase in energy. More significant benefits, like changes in body composition or enhanced recovery, often become apparent over two to three months. This is because the therapy works by supporting your body’s natural hormone production and repair mechanisms, which take time to manifest.
Consistent adherence to the prescribed protocol is essential for optimal results. You will likely have follow-up appointments or check-ins with your clinician. These allow them to monitor your progress and make any necessary adjustments to your therapy. Ongoing communication ensures the treatment remains tailored to your evolving needs. Long-term benefits are often sustained with continued, appropriate use and lifestyle support.
